Description

The Surgident Osseodensification Sinus Expansion Drill (SED) Kit is a precision-engineered osseodensification system designed for safe and predictable crestal approach sinus floor elevation in dental implant surgery. The kit combines a sequence of five sinus expansion drills (2.5 to 4.2 mm) with seven depth-control stoppers (4 to 10 mm), allowing the surgeon to incrementally expand the osteotomy while gently lifting the Schneiderian membrane through controlled hydraulic pressure rather than cutting. The bone-preserving design conserves and densifies the residual ridge instead of excavating it, maintaining the critical bone volume needed for implant primary stability. The stopper system locks each drill to a defined depth — a critical safety feature when working millimeters from the maxillary sinus floor. Supplied non-sterile in an organized cassette with positions for the guide drill, expansion drills, and depth stoppers for chairside efficiency.

Key Features

  • Osseodensification approach preserves and densifies residual bone rather than excavating it
  • Five sinus expansion drills covering Ø2.5, 2.8, 3.3, 3.7, and 4.2 mm diameters
  • Seven depth-control stoppers (4 to 10 mm) lock drilling depth for safe sinus floor approach
  • Ø2.0 mm guide drill (SD-GD20) for initial pilot osteotomy
  • Recommended drilling speed of 800 to 1200 RPM with copious irrigation
  • Stainless steel drills with silicone ring and titanium components for surgical-grade durability
  • Organized cassette with labeled positions for chairside efficiency and infection control
  • Fully autoclavable for sterile repeatable use across implant-with-sinus-elevation cases

Specifications

  • Product Type: Sinus Expansion (Osseodensification) Drill Kit
  • Brand: Surgident
  • Model Code: SD-SED
  • Application: Crestal approach sinus floor elevation in dental implant surgery
  • Sinus Expansion Drills: 5 drills — Ø2.5, 2.8, 3.3, 3.7, 4.2 mm
  • Guide Drill: 1 drill — Ø2.0 mm (SD-GD20)
  • Depth Stoppers: 7 stoppers — 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10 mm
  • Recommended Drilling Speed: 800 to 1200 RPM
  • Materials: Stainless steel, silicone ring, titanium
  • Supply Condition: Non-sterile (sterilize before clinical use)
  • Sterilization: Autoclavable (121°C / 30 min or 132°C / 15-25 min)
  • EO Gas Sterilization: Compatible per ISO 11135
  • Cassette: Organized labeled case with spare slot

Directions for Use

Pre-Surgical Planning

  • Measure the depth of the residual bone of the maxillary sinus through pre-operative X-ray or CBCT imaging
  • Plan the implant position, diameter, and required sinus floor elevation height
  • Verify the case is suitable for crestal sinus elevation (typically 4-8 mm of residual ridge height)
  • Confirm the patient has no contraindications such as active sinus pathology, immune deficiency, or relevant systemic conditions

Kit Preparation

  • Sterilize the complete kit via autoclave following the recommended protocol (121°C / 30 min or 132°C / 15-25 min)
  • Open the sterilized cassette and verify all drills, stoppers, and accessories are present
  • Arrange the drilling sequence — guide drill first, then expansion drills in ascending diameter order

Guide Drilling

  • Attach the Ø2.0 mm guide drill (SD-GD20) to a compatible surgical motor handpiece
  • Set the rotation speed to 800-1200 RPM with copious saline irrigation
  • Drill the pilot osteotomy to 2 mm shorter than the measured residual bone depth
  • Example: if measured residual bone depth is 6 mm, use the number 4 stopper (SDST-04) to limit guide drilling depth

Sinus Expansion Drilling

  • For safety, mount a stopper one number lower than the planned final drilling depth on the sinus expansion drill
  • Example: For 5 mm depth drilling, mount the number 4 stopper (SDST-04)
  • Begin with the smallest sinus expansion drill (SED-25, Ø2.5 mm) at 800-1200 RPM with copious irrigation
  • Drill until the stopper reaches the alveolar crest — this safely limits drilling depth
  • Progress through the expansion drills in ascending diameter (SED-28 → SED-33 → SED-37 → SED-42) per the planned implant diameter
  • The drills incrementally expand the osteotomy while preserving bone through the osseodensification effect

Progressive Depth Extension

  • If drilling is not complete when the stopper reaches the alveolar crest, replace the stopper with one of higher number and continue drilling
  • Example: If the number 5 stopper (SDST-05) is not enough, switch to number 6 (SDST-06) to drill deeper
  • Progress the depth gradually to gently lift the Schneiderian membrane through controlled hydraulic pressure
  • Avoid sudden deep drilling — the controlled stopper-based approach is essential for sinus floor safety

Sinus Floor Elevation and Graft Placement

  • Verify the sinus floor has been lifted to the planned height without membrane perforation
  • Place the chosen bone graft material into the prepared site to fill the elevated compartment
  • Proceed with implant placement using the implant manufacturer’s protocol

Post Use Care

  • Disassemble all components and rinse with flowing water to remove body fluids and debris
  • Clean each drill and stopper thoroughly using suitable brushes (do not use metal brushes or steel wool)
  • Use a surgical instrument cleaner per the cleaner manufacturer’s instructions
  • Rinse three times in flowing or distilled water for 20 seconds each
  • Air-dry or wipe with clean cloth and alcohol to prevent water spots
  • Sterilize via autoclave or EO gas per the recommended protocols
  • Return all components to their designated positions in the cassette for storage
